Fresh install of Jenkins
Create "new item", free style project. called TEST
Set "Advanced Project Options" and "use custom workspace" path.

Under "Source Code Management" Subversion.
Set the URL
Click "add more locations"
Set additional URL.

Start the TEST

After checking out the first location, the second checkout wipes out the first

So the checkout is left with only the second checkout. I didn't find a way to workaround this problem.
